Can GeForce GTX 1060 run Em-A-Li?

Great

The GeForce GTX 1060 handles Em-A-Li well at 1080p, delivering approximately 473 FPS at High settings — above the 60 FPS target for smooth gameplay. It can also achieve smooth 1440p at around 355 FPS.

About

Em-A-Li, released in 2020, is a captivating horror RPG that invites players into a uniquely immersive experience. In this game, you take on the role of Em-A-Li, who guides players through a gripping narrative filled with suspense and eerie atmospheres. Its standout feature is the voice acting, which enhances the storytelling and player engagement, making every decision feel consequential as you escape through chilling environments.
